Commit Message

Power, Ciara Sept. 30, 2020, 1:04 p.m. UTC
  When choosing a vector path to take, an extra condition must be
satisfied to ensure the max SIMD bitwidth allows for the CPU enabled
path.

Patch

diff --git a/drivers/net/mlx5/mlx5_rxtx_vec.c b/drivers/net/mlx5/mlx5_rxtx_vec.c
index 711dcd35fa..c384c737dc 100644
--- a/drivers/net/mlx5/mlx5_rxtx_vec.c
+++ b/drivers/net/mlx5/mlx5_rxtx_vec.c
@@ -148,6 +148,8 @@  mlx5_check_vec_rx_support(struct rte_eth_dev *dev)
 	struct mlx5_priv *priv = dev->data->dev_private;
 	uint32_t i;
 
+	if (rte_get_max_simd_bitwidth() < RTE_MAX_128_SIMD)
+		return -ENOTSUP;
 	if (!priv->config.rx_vec_en)
 		return -ENOTSUP;
 	if (mlx5_mprq_enabled(dev))
